Transaction 39e72dd62390e9bdda45987a65c28d9a082453ee9baca8ee6c4d77089f6bbdda
1 Input
1 Output
-
39e72dd62390e9bdda45987a65c28d9a082453ee9baca8ee6c4d77089f6bbdda:0
- value
- 44708984
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d2510e4fec3413caf8ee69a1ca7ae111a64f549
- address
- bc1qm5j3pe87cdqnetuwu6dpefawzydxfa2f5jy0vk